Two Pakistani civilians killed in Indian forces firing at LoC

  • July 08, 2017

According to ISPR, Indian forces fired small arms and heavy weapons along the LoC in Chirikot and Satwal sectors.

Two individuals including a girl were killed and three citizens were injured in the incident, the ISPR said, adding that Pakistan Army troops effectively responded to the Indian firing.

Kashmir has been divided between India and Pakistan since the end of British colonial rule in 1947. Both claim it in full and have fought two wars over the mountainous region.

Despite November 2003 ceasefire agreement, there have been repeated outbreaks of firing across the LoC, with both sides reporting deaths and injuries including of civilians.
